Job description

The London office of Vivienne Westwood is currently recruiting a Designer in the Womenswear Design Department for Maternity Cover. This is a challenging and superb opportunity for a talented designer to join a luxury and successful brand.


The applicant will be required to have suitable skills to fulfil the following tasks:

  • Fully integrate and communicate within the Menswear Team and all other employees in the company.
  • Working as Senior Designer in a team with Vivienne Westwood and Andreas Kronthaler as Creative Directors
  • Leading and controlling the workflow, overall and in detail, from concept to completion according to Vivienne’s and Andreas’ brief. At the same time following the structure of the merchandising plan which is given and approved at the beginning of each season, ensuring that design and creative projects are delivered on time.
  • Following sales reports weekly and SWOT analysis to ensure product is on target for its market.
  • Researching and designing new developments of the collection (style ideas, fabrics, artworks, details, finishing, etc.) for outerwear, tailoring, shirts, dresses, and tops.
  • Presenting the collection to internal sales and merchandising teams several times per season to fulfil their needs.
  • Managing design meetings with the team, whereby new ideas and designs get discussed and approved.
  • Attending all fittings with design team and various production companies (London and Milan).
  • Liaising with the product development and fabric team regarding all deadlines (design, fabric, fittings).
  • Meeting together with the fabric team suppliers to source and develop fabrics, embellishments, trims, and hardware.
  • Collaborating with print / graphic designers and fabric team on artworks and fabric developments.
  • Collaborating closely together with Marketing team: Attending digital / online / internal / campaign photoshoots (casting, fitting, styling) as well as seasonal fashion events. Also creating and organising styling items for them.
  • Providing technical presentations and documents for each season as well as doing all spec drawings.

Skills and experience:

  • Previous experience in a Luxury Brand
  • Design or fashion related qualifications
  • Understanding of the critical path with the ability to work to seasonal deadlines.
  • Ability to design across both graphic and garments
  • Pattern making, draping and sketching skills.
  • Knowledge of textile and ability to identify and manipulate fabric
  • Proficient in Adobe Illustrator and in Photoshop. To also have a good understanding and use of Microsoft Office and Excel.
